Learning about equity capital:
Equity capital is defined as the portion of the capital of an organization which investors purchase for a portion of the ownership of the company in the form of shares. These investors have held over the management. While they enjoy the benefits of ownership, they also bear the risks as well. Advantages of equity capital
There are quite a few advantages of equity capital. These are as follows:
- Since there are no maturity dates, the firm is not obliged to redeem the equity shares from the investors.
- The credit of the company is raised with the equity capital. As more number of equity shares are raised, it acts as a cushion for money lenders to offer more money to the company.
- There will be no legal consequences for a company if the skip paying the equity dividends due to cash deficit.
What are dividend policies?
The dividend policy is the set of guidelines adopted by a company that decides how much of its earnings it will pay out to its shareholders. The dividend irrelevance theory is based on such a policy that allows the company to sell its equities for cash. What are the various types of dividend policies available?
There are generally three types of dividend policies that companies adopt. These are: Residual, stable and constant. While a residual dividend policy is highly volatile, however, for investors it is the policy that companies should adopt as the company pays out the leftover after paying for expenditure and working capital needs.
Stable dividend policy is the popular one in use. In this, steady dividends are paid out every year which attracts more number of investors. The market doesn’t affect the dividends; when shares are up they receive dividends and even when it is down, they receive dividends. The constant dividend policy involves the payment of the company’s earnings each year. So, if earnings are up, investors receive more, but if it is down, they receive less.
